在vue.config.js 文件中,可以通过 configureWebpack 选项来配置 webpack 的 devtool 属性,以启用 Source Maps。 javascript module.exports = { // 开发环境下启用 Source Maps configureWebpack: (config) => { if (process.env.NODE_ENV === 'development') { config.devtool = 'source-map'; //...
Vue CLI 对于使用Vue CLI创建的项目,可以在项目的vue.config.js文件中配置: 找到或者在项目根目录下创建一个vue.config.js文件。 修改或添加配置项以开启sourcemap。对于生产环境和开发环境,你可以分别配置: module.exports= {configureWebpack: {devtool:'source-map',// 为不同的环境设置不同的source-mapproduct...
在设置了vue.config.js之后,就不会生成map文件,map文件的作用在于:项目打包后,代码都是经过压缩加密的,如果运行时报错,输出的错误信息无法准确得知是哪里的代码报错。也就是说map文件相当于是查看源码的一个东西。如果不需要定位问题,并且不想被看到源码,就把productionSourceMap 2.打包的配置 在vue.config.js文件中...
(1)在webpack的配置文件的module.exports中加入(推荐development下使用): devtool:"eval-source-map", 1. 特点:如果代码报错了,点击调试区能够获取到没有压缩的源码: (2)在webpack的配置文件的module.exports中加入(推荐production下使用): devtool:"nosources-source-map", 1. 特点:能够看到开发环境对应的错误...
生产环境的 source map,可以将其设置为 false 以加速生产环境构建,默认值是true module.exports= { productionSourceMap:false, } 7、devServer 可通过devServer.proxy解决前后端跨域问题(反向代理) module.exports= {// 反向代理devServer: { index:'/login.html',//默认打开文件open:true,//自动打开浏览器host...
vue-cli3 + webpack 打包生成的文件中不包含map文件,我需要在开发环境和生产环境都产出map vue.config.js中配置如下 module.exports = { // 选项... lintOnSave: false, runtimeCompiler: true, productionSourceMap: true, devServer: { port: 8084, ...
笔者最近在使用win10自带的OneNote笔记本记笔记的时候,发现笔者电脑中没有华文新魏这个字体,最开始以为...
config.optimization.minimizer('css').use(CssMinimizerPlugin,[{sourceMap:true,},]) 4. 编译查看效果 到这里配置就结束了,接下来给大家分享一下这段不堪的踩坑之路 踩坑历程 我司使用 vue-cli 初始化了一个新项目,目前临近上线,需要完善配置相关的东西。里面有一项就是私有化 sourceMap 部署:即 .map 文件与...
config.plugin('SourceMapDevToolPlugin') .use(webpack.SourceMapDevToolPlugin).tap(args => { return [{ filename: '[file].map', publicPath: 'https://exmaple.com/', moduleFilenameTemplate: 'source-map' }] }) }} 然后你兴奋的去运行npm run build ...
module.exports = { devServer: { //开发环境下设置为编译好以后直接打开浏览器浏览 open: true }, configureWebpack: config => { //调试JS config.devtool = "source-map"